The Distributive PropertyThe process of distributing the number

on the outside of the parentheses to each term on the inside.a(b + c) = ab + ac and (b + c) a = ba + ca

a(b - c) = ab - ac and (b - c) a = ba - ca

Example #1

5(x + 7)

5 • x + 5 • 7

5x + 35

Page 3: Section 1.5 distributive property (algebra)

Example #2

3(m - 4)3 • m - 3 • 4

3m - 12

Example #3

-2(y + 3)-2 • y + (-2) • 3

-2y + (-6)-2y - 6

Like Terms are terms with the same variable AND exponent.

To simplify expressions with like terms, simply combine the like terms.

Page 8: Section 1.5 distributive property (algebra)

Are these like terms?

1) 13k, 22k

Yes, the variables are the same.

2) 5ab, 4ba

Yes, the order of the variables doesn’t matter.

3) x3y, xy3

No, the exponents are on different variables.
